Step 1: Slice and Season Chicken

Cut chicken breasts into small, bite-sized chunks about an inch wide.

Sprinkle with seasonings:
  • Garlic powder
  • Onion powder
  • Cumin
  • Salt
  • Black pepper

Step 2: Sizzle Chicken to Golden Perfection

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Toss seasoned chicken pieces into the hot pan.

Cook while stirring frequently, about 5-7 minutes until chicken turns golden brown and is fully cooked.

Drain any excess liquid to prevent sogginess.

Step 3: Create Flavor-Packed Liquid Base

Pour into the skillet:
  • Chicken broth
  • Nacho cheese sauce
  • Rotel tomatoes

Stir ingredients and bring to a rolling boil.

Watch as the queso and broth merge into a mouthwatering sauce.

Step 4: Transform into One-Pot Wonder

Mix uncooked long-grain white rice into the boiling mixture.

Ensure rice grains are completely submerged.

Cover skillet with lid, reduce heat to medium-low.

Simmer 20-25 minutes until liquid absorbs and rice becomes tender.

Add extra broth if rice needs more cooking time.

Step 5: Garnish and Serve

Fluff rice with a fork.

Transfer to serving plates immediately.

Top with delicious garnishes:
  • Sour cream
  • Sliced avocado
  • Fresh cilantro

Enjoy your creamy, cheesy chicken rice feast!

How to Store Queso Chicken Leftovers

  • Store leftovers in an airtight container and keep in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Cool completely before sealing to prevent moisture buildup.
  • Transfer to freezer-safe containers, removing as much air as possible. Freeze for up to 2 months. Separate rice and chicken if possible to maintain better texture.
  • Place portion in microwave-safe dish, sprinkle few tablespoons of water or extra broth to prevent drying. Cover with damp paper towel and heat in 30-second intervals, stirring between each to distribute heat evenly.
  • Warm in skillet over medium-low heat, adding splash of chicken broth to restore moisture. Stir gently and frequently to prevent sticking and ensure even heating, about 5-7 minutes until thoroughly warmed.

FAQs

  • What type of rice works best for this recipe?

Long-grain white rice is ideal because it cooks evenly and absorbs flavors well without becoming mushy. It provides the perfect texture for this one-pot chicken and queso dish.

  •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breasts?

Absolutely! Chicken thighs work great and can add more flavor. Just ensure they’re cut into similar-sized pieces and cooked thoroughly. The cooking time might need a slight adjustment.

  • Is this recipe spicy?

The Rotel tomatoes can add a mild kick, but it’s not typically considered a very spicy dish. If you want more heat, you can add extra hot sauce or choose a spicier version of Rotel. For less heat, use original Rotel or mild salsa.

  • How can I make this recipe healthier?

Use low-sodium chicken broth, choose a reduced-fat nacho cheese sauce, and add extra vegetables like bell peppers or corn. You can also use lean chicken breast and control the portion size to make it more nutritious.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Proteins:

  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breast

Seasonings:

  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on onion pow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on cumin
  • 0.5 teaspoon kosher sal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per

Cooking Liquids and Additional Ingredients:

  • 1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
  • 2.25 cups chicken broth
  • 1 can (15 ounces) nacho cheese sauce
  • 1 can (10 ounces) Rotel
  • 1.5 cups uncooked long-grain white rice

Instructions

  1. Dice chicken breasts into uniform 1-inch cubes, then generously coat with a blend of garlic powder, onion powder, cumin, salt, and pepper for robust flavor infusion.
  2.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ering. Carefully introduce seasoned chicken pieces, sautéing for 5-7 minutes while stirring consistently to ensure golden-brown exterior and complete internal cooking. Discard any excess liquid to maintain dish integrity.
  3. Introduce chicken broth, nacho cheese sauce, and Rotel to the skillet, stirring thoroughly to create a cohesive, bubbling sauce that will serve as the foundation for the dish.
  4. Incorporate uncooked long-grain white rice into the liquid mixture, ensuring complete grain submersion. Cover skillet with lid, reduce heat to medium-low, and allow contents to simmer for 20-25 minutes until liquid is fully absorbed and rice reaches tender consistency.
  5. Gently fluff rice with a fork to separate grains. Transfer to serving dishes and embellish with preferred taco accompaniments such as sour cream, diced avocado, and fresh cilantro for an elevated culinary experience.

Notes

  • Choose chicken breasts with uniform thickness to ensure even cooking and prevent dry or undercooked sections.
  • Pat chicken dry before seasoning to help achieve a golden-brown exterior and enhance flavor absorption.
  • Adjust spice levels by increasing or decreasing cumin and pepper quantities to suit personal taste preferences.
  • Use low-sodium chicken broth to control salt content and prevent the dish from becoming too salty.
  • For a gluten-free version, verify that nacho cheese sauce and Rotel are certified gluten-free before using.
  • Swap white rice with cauliflower rice for a lower-carb alternative that maintains the dish’s creamy texture.
